J'exécute une application Rails (Ruby on Rails
) et je souhaite commencer à collecter des données de conversion pour le commerce électronique. J'ai installé Google Analytics sur un serveur local (environnement de développement) et je peux voir les données des visites locales (alias/tunneled localhost:3000
) et suivre les conversions d'objectifs en temps réel sans problème. Cependant, je ne peux pas voir de conversions e-comm. Voici à quoi ressemble l'extrait JS:
<script>
...
// tacking code
// ga(create)
...
ga('send', 'pageview');
ga('require', 'ecommerce');
ga('ecommerce:addTransaction', {
'id' : '298',
'affiliation' : 'Tax',
'revenue' : '0.0',
'shipping' : '0.0',
'tax' : '0.0'
});
ga('ecommerce:addItem', {
'id' : '227',
'sku' : '227',
'name' : 'Alpha 0 featured listing',
'category': 'Appliances',
'price' : '23.34',
'quantity': '1'
});
ga('ecommerce:send');
</script>
Les appels d'objet ecommerce
sont ajoutés à la page thank-you
. Sinon, seul l'événement pageView
est envoyé. Est-ce que je me trompe en combinant addItem
et addTransaction
?
Je suis capable de voir les deux hitType
vars envoyés via google_analytics_debug.js
Accédez à votre page d'administration Google Analytics et vérifiez si le commerce électronique est activé dans votre VIEW (activé). Assurez-vous également que vous avez créé un objectif pour suivre la conversion vers cette page "Merci".
Si vous utilisez un objectif de destination sur la page "merci", n'oubliez pas de laisser le champ Valeur de l'objectif vide.